The ILA GmbH was founded in 1995 as a spin-off company of the Berlin Technical University. At the beginning, ILA achieved the development of simple 1D LDV systems. These systems have proven to be extremely precise and to present an extraordinary long term stability, due to their extremely stable design and light sources. These LDV systems have been taken till today as reference standard for the calibration of velocity sensors.
